Three Gauchos qualify for state

The Saddleback men's cross country team finished in 15th place at the Southern California Regional Finals on Friday in Cerritos.  The Gauchos had three runners qualify for the state meet in Fresno.

Saddleback came within an eyelash of qualifying as a team, finishing one spot out of the mix.  With 14 programs qualifying, the Gauchos finished in 15th place and just seven points behind 14th place Orange Coast College.

As tough as that was to swallow, it wasn't all a loss for the men's team as three individuals qualified for the state meet in two weeks.  Scott Hickman, Julian Lasting and Sebastian Arias all qualified based upon their finish on Friday, meaning 50% of the team had a qualifying time.

Hickman (pictured middle) has been on a roll as of late and finished in 26th place overall on Friday.  A week after finishing third at the Orange Empire Conference Finals, Hickman crossed the finish line in 20:17.4, which was 1:25 faster than his time on the same course six weeks earlier.

Lasting and Arias had similar stories.  Lasting (pictured right) finished in 38th place overall when he crossed the line in 20:27.4, cutting 1:09 off his time at the SoCal Preview.  Arias (pictured left) finished in 74th place on Friday by running the 4-mile course in 21:13.6, chopping 35 seconds off his time from mid-September.

Hickman, Lasting and Arias will compete at the CCCAA State Finals at Woodward Park in Fresno on November 17.
